📈 3. Favor Lower-Risk Setups
Instead of entering hard at current levels:
Use small initial entries + scaling — e.g., split into 3 parts:
Part 1: near strong historical support
Part 2: if price reclaims higher intermediate resistance
Part 3: only if market structure flips bullish (e.g., higher highs on daily candles)
This reduces emotional losses in volatile environments.
📉 4. Monitor Funding Rates & Liquidity
Negative funding (more shorts paying longs) indicates bearish pressure.
A shift to neutral or positive funding might signal selling exhaustion — a better signal to start bigger positions.
(You can view this in most futures interfaces.)
